Persistent cloud cover and scattered thunderstorms tied to the Intertropical Convergence Zone are moderating Manila's diurnal temperature range for September 20, keeping official model consensus centered on nighttime lows near 24–26 °C. Heavy rainfall suppresses daytime heating while limiting nocturnal radiative cooling, reducing the likelihood of extremes below 22 °C or above 30 °C. PAGASA monitoring of a distant tropical cyclone and potential southwest monsoon enhancement introduces modest forecast spread, sustaining the near-even market split between sub-21 °C and 31 °C+ outcomes. Updated numerical guidance and the next PAGASA briefing within 24 hours will likely refine these probabilities ahead of resolution.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the lowest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=rpll
If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source.
In the event that there is no data for the observation date by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, this market will resolve to the lowest bracket.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C.
This market will resolve once the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source, or by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, whichever comes first.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
